About us

Clap your hands… Stamp your feet… It's time to say helloooo, It's time to say hello!

Tiny Tales playful storytelling sessions are back this October. Giving you and your tiny person the chance to explore stories together through creative play and interactive fun! Led by our experienced early years facilitator, Tiny Tales will spark your child's imagination and develop their curiosity about the world around them. We are very excited to trial these sessions out in The Nook! And for FREE as part of our pop-up library offer this half term.

We have plenty of space for prams and fully accessible changing facilities are also available.

Limited places are available so book to secure your place. Please let us know as soon as possible if you can no longer attend, so that we can offer that place to another family.

Tuesday 29th October – The Three Little Pigs by Mara Alperin

My First Fairytales are a magical introduction to those unforgettable stories that are a key part of almost every childhood. Take a look at this well-loved classic while exploring the pop-up library's overarching theme of sustainability. We wonder… did the little pigs think about sustainable housing when they build their homes?

Wednesday 30th October – Somebody Swallowed Stanley by Sarah Roberts

Everybody has a taste for Stanley – and the other ocean creatures just keep mistaking him for a delicious treat – but this is no ordinary jellyfish. Most jellyfish have dangly-gangly tentacles, but Stanley has two handles… Other jellyfish have a magical glow, but Stanley has stripes… Because Stanley (spoiler alert) is a plastic bag! Take a look at this brightly illustrated picture book while exploring the pop-up library's overarching theme of sustainability and plastic in our seas.

Saturday 2nd November – We're Going on a Bear Hunt by Michael Rosen

We're going on a bear hunt. We're going to catch a big one. Will you come too? Swish and swash, splash and splosh your way through this journey with us. Take a look at this award-winning favourite while exploring the pop- up library's overarching theme of sustainability and the importance of the outdoors.

The Nook is Theatre Royal Plymouth's pop-up library and event space, bringing young people together for storytelling and free activities this Autumn half term.
